How was Alexander Graham Bell a crucial part of the move into industry?

Respuesta :

Iyanisimon0909
Iyanisimon0909 Iyanisimon0909
  • 01-05-2020

Answer:

His creation of the telephone was important. People had faster communication and it made factory work easier.
